3. LED indicators
¥
(LED flashes green)
OK
Action was successfully completed (e.g. SAFE-O-TRONIC is locked or unlocked)
¥
(LED flashes red)
megaKey not authorized
Possible cause:
Handling error (actuation sequence incorrect).
Wrong SAFE-O-TRONIC (megaKey is not assigned to this SAFE-O-TRONIC or has already
locked another SAFE-O-TRONIC).
Group number of SAFE-O-TRONIC and megaKey or MasterKey are different.
megaKey does not belong to the system (wrong System IDs).
Data on megaKey are incorrect or corrupt.
Possible remedies:
Retry.
Display the megalock number of the megaKey on the Infoterminal.
Initialize megaKey for system.
Reinitialize megaKey.

(LED flashes alternately red and green)
Battery alarm
Possible cause:
Battery voltage on the SAFE-O-TRONIC is too low (megalock can’t be locked).
Remedies:
Block SAFE-O-TRONIC using MasterKey II.
Replace battery immediately !

(LED flashes red/green at same time)SAFE-O-TRONIC is blocked / wrong
megaKey
Possible cause:
SAFE-O-TRONIC was unlocked (locked) with MasterKey I or blocked by MasterKey II.
MasterKey Generation of MasterKey I or MasterKey II is wrong (old MasterKey).
Operating mode of SAFE-O-TRONIC and megaKey do not agree
SAFE-O-TRONIC for free cabinet select with fixed-megaKey or multi-megaKey
SAFE-O-TRONIC for fixed cabinet assignment with free-megaKey or multi-megaKey
SAFE-O-TRONIC in multi-user mode and free-megaKey or fixed-megaKey
SAFE-O-TRONIC is not configured.
Possible remedies:
Use MasterKey II to enable SAFE-O-TRONIC .
Check megaKey.
Use SetupKey to configure SAFE-O-TRONIC .

(LEDs constant on red and green)
internal fault
Possible cause:
SAFE-O-TRONIC is defective.
Remedies:
1. Replace SAFE-O-TRONIC .
